How much does a Financial Advisor IV make in Missouri? The average Financial Advisor IV salary in Missouri is $102,316 as of March 26, 2024, but the range typically falls between $90,368 and $119,740.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on the city and many other important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ession.

Financial Advisor IV Salaries by Percentile
Percentile Salary Location Last Updated
10th Percentile Financial Advisor IV Salary $79,491 MO March 26, 2024
25th Percentile Financial Advisor IV Salary $90,368 MO March 26, 2024
50th Percentile Financial Advisor IV Salary $102,316 MO March 26, 2024
75th Percentile Financial Advisor IV Salary $119,740 MO March 26, 2024
90th Percentile Financial Advisor IV Salary $135,603 MO March 26, 2024

Job Description for Financial Advisor IV

Financial Advisor IV develops individualized wealth management financial plans and recommendations to help clients attain financial goals by selecting investment solutions to minimize risk and grow wealth. Uses broad knowledge of investment products to educate clients on available investment options and create planning scenarios for retirement, education savings, and other financial objectives. Being a Financial Advisor IV keeps abreast of economic conditions and new financial products to inform and advise clients on potential enhancements to existing financial plans and create up-sell opportunities. Monitors client portfolios to ensure appropriate risk profile. Additionally, Financial Advisor IV follows all regulatory and organizational policies and procedures. May be involved with selling or coordinating the purchase of additional financial products or services to clients. Requires a bachelor's degree in finance, accounting, business or equivalent. Typically has the Certified Financial Planner (CFP) designation. Typically reports to a manager. The Financial Advisor IV work is highly independent. May assume a team lead role for the work group. A specialist on complex technical and business matters. To be a Financial Advisor IV typically requires 7+ years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)... View full job description

Career Path for Financial Advisor IV

A career path is a sequence of jobs that leads to your short- and long-term career goals. Some follow a linear career path within one field, while others change fields periodically to achieve career or personal goals.

For Financial Advisor IV, the first career path typically progresses to Financial Advising Director.

Additionally, the second career path typically starts with a Private Banking Manager position, and then progresses to Private Banking Director.
